Ko Iso

Ko Iso, (born April 10th, 1987) is a Nihon Ki-in pro. He become pro in 2002, reaching 2-dan in the same year, and 4 dan in 2005. He was promoted from 4 dan to 7-dan on 27 October 2005 when he beat Kono Rin to claim a berth in the Meijin league. At that time, he was the youngest player to have played in a league. 8 dan in 2011. November 3, 2019, 9-dan (Number of wins = 200 wins).
He was runner-up in the 2006 Shinjin O. In 2008 he won the first YugenCup. After some period of weak results, he'll be in the 67th Honinbo league.
He is also known as Huang Yih Tzuu, and his name is displayed as such on the Nihon Ki-in page.
